Poll Update #3
1. Most favorite character
Roarke is still in the lead and increasing the margin (52%) with Eve coming in second (37%). Peabody is a distant 3rd.
2. The character you'd like to see in a major storyline
Nadine Furst now has a commanding lead over Troy Trueheart (41% vs 27%) but Troy's percentage dropped as Baxter (16%) got some more love. Maybe in 2014 Nadine finds love???
3. Favorite novella
Possession in Death (In Death, #31.5) has surged ahead and is the popular vote (32%), followed by Interlude in Death (15%), a distant second.
4. Who's the Candy Thief?
Only a few votes separates the leader, all of them being involved (21%), versus Baxter (20%) and the entire Homicide Department (18%). Baxter had a big surge since the last update. No matter which, everyone seems to believe he's involved at a minimum.
5. Favorite full-length book
Naked in Death is still the group favorite (35%) and Innocent in Death still comes in second (12%) but lost a little ground. Â
6. How many times have you re-read the series?
Most of our members have read the series more than once (52%), which is pretty incredible. The rest have either only read the series once or not completed it yet (48%).
7. Your favorite supporting character (aside from Peabody and McNab)
Summerset now has a slight lead over Mavis (30% vs 27%). Dr. Mira comes in at a close third (22%). We do seem to appreciate the characters that love Eve and Roarke unconditionally.
8. Which author did you read first - J. D. Robb or Nora Roberts?
Most of you started with Nora (57%) and less than 10% of our members haven't read her yet. That's a surprising number given how different these books are to Nora's stories.
